I aquired the URL a day or 2 ago. (I have been doing a lot of research lately, my head hurts)

http://www.hailware.com/

Above is the software's homepage. You can even download the script. It says its a sourceforge project and there isn't any indication that it would steal your passwords. I do think that because its a sourceforge project (open source), that it's pretty safe. Also mentioned there is a speculation that psidreams 2.0 should have a hotmail fix.

If this code is low on a server and doesn't use too much bandwidth, I might set it up at onlineconsoles. I need to install it, and test it first. Since it's open source, and if this was a malicious script....people would have found out by now just from other programmers looking at the code. Software seems completly legit to me.
